The Reason Why Cheating Can Feel “Sweet” 😂

Cheating—whether in relationships, friendships, or even little personal indulgences—is usually frowned upon. Yet, some people say it can feel exciting or even “sweet.” Why? Let’s break it down.

1. The Thrill of the Forbidden

There’s something about doing what you shouldn’t that triggers excitement. The risk makes the heart race, and the secrecy adds a rush that can feel strangely satisfying.

2. Instant Gratification

Cheating often provides instant emotional or physical rewards—attention, affection, or pleasure that might be missing in a current relationship. This immediate “boost” can make it feel addictive or sweet, even if it’s wrong.

3. Feeling Desired

Being wanted by someone outside your relationship can give a temporary ego boost. It validates your attractiveness or charm, and that recognition can feel intoxicating.

4. Escaping Routine

Sometimes relationships can feel predictable. Cheating introduces novelty, excitement, or new energy that breaks the monotony—at least temporarily.

5. Temporary Emotional Escape

Cheating can serve as a distraction from personal problems or relationship struggles. It’s a way to escape reality, even if it’s not a healthy one.

The Reality Check

While cheating can feel “sweet” in the moment, it often comes with guilt, heartbreak, and long-term consequences. The thrill is temporary, but the damage can last far longer.

So yes, it can feel sweet… but it’s never truly worth the price. Relationships built on trust, honesty, and respect are the ones that last—and that’s the real sweetness. 💖
